Output d73585b70ab83e384d2561aa102e00ee857768f50a3203d8d04313aa1a219464:25

value
1165483612
script pubkey
OP_0 OP_PUSHBYTES_32 85267399a6d1c76f4fd875aa64e6ae4dfbcaadf1ef767c5d4745cc2108e7cabb
address
bc1qs5n88xdx68rk7n7cwk4xfe4wfhau4t03aam8ch28ghxzzz88e2as98kk0u
transaction
d73585b70ab83e384d2561aa102e00ee857768f50a3203d8d04313aa1a219464
spent
true